How our sorting works

The order in which job vacancies are displayed is determined by a composite score based on the following factors:

  • Keyword Relevance: How well your search terms match the vacancy details. We prioritize matches found in the job title, followed by job requirements, location names, and educational levels. Matches within general employer information or the organization's name carry a lower weight.
  • Commercial Prioritization (Premium Jobs): Vacancies paid for by employers ('Premium' or 'Sponsored') receive a ranking boost and will appear higher in the search results.
  • Recency (Date Relevance): Newer vacancies are prioritized. The relevance score of a vacancy is reduced by half once the posting is older than 30 days.
  • Proximity (Distance Relevance): Vacancies located closer to your search location are ranked higher. For vacancies located more than 30 km from the search center, the relevance score is halved.
The final ranking is established by multiplying all these individual factors to calculate the total relevance score.

    Role Profile: Teacher of Business Studies

    Location: Huddersfield Grammar School - Yorkshire

    Contract: Fixed Term-Part Time

    Hours: 15 Hours per Week - Thursdays and Fridays

    Salary: Up to £43,635 FTE (subject to a September pay review) depending on experience

    Start Date: September 2026


    UK Applicants Only - No Sponsorship Available


    About the School - Huddersfield Grammar


    We are a highly successful independent school in Yorkshire, providing a future-facing curriculum for the next generation of leaders. Our academic results are exceptional, with a focus on pupil wellbeing and character development at the heart of all we do.

    Set in beautiful grounds, we provide children from ages 3-16 a caring, supportive environment in which to learn. Children are inspired from the very beginning of their educational journey in Nursery and Reception, and this continues right through the Pre-Preparatory, Preparatory and Senior School.


    Huddersfield Grammar School offers academic stretch and an enviable co-curricular programme. We are renowned for our rich vein of kindness and inclusivity. We encourage our pupils to work hard, aspire to high academic standards and we delight in watching them become fully-rounded members of the school and community.

    The school now has an exciting opportunity for an experienced Teacher of Business Studies to join our fantastic team.


    About the role

    To deliver high-quality teaching and learning in Business Studies across Key Stages 3 and 4, enabling students to achieve strong academic outcomes and develop a sound understanding of business concepts and real-world economic issues. The post-holder will contribute to curriculum development, support student progress, and uphold the school’s commitment to excellence, inclusion and safeguarding.


    What you will be doing

    Key Responsibilities

    • Teach Business Studies up to GCSE level, delivering engaging and relevant lessons.
    • Plan and deliver high-quality learning aligned with departmental schemes of work.
    • Set ambitious targets and provide clear, constructive feedback.
    • Maintain accurate assessment records and contribute to departmental tracking.
    • Inspire pupils to develop commercial awareness, critical thinking and enterprise skills.
    • Contribute to curriculum development and departmental improvement.
    • Support the wider school community through extracurricular activities, such as enterprise clubs, competitions or trips.
    • Being aware of and complying with all school policies, including those relating to teaching and learning, and assessment


    What you’ll bring

    • Qualified teacher status
    • A Good Honours Degree
    • Enthusiasm for and knowledge of the subject
    • An ability to communicate effectively with parents, pupils and staff in a variety of ways
    • An ability to think originally and creatively, and to show initiative
    • A commitment to support the ethos of the school
    • An ability to cope with a busy working day and a varied programme of teaching
    • Evidence of the ability to work as a member of a team
    • A clear understanding of how to engage with school data
    • Excellent attendance record
    • High standards of professionalism
